Breakthroughs4
You only need one embryo when it's the right one - numbers don't determine your success
Robin had only one embryo from donor eggs after eight eggs were thawed, three fertilized, and only one became viable. That single embryo resulted in her pregnancy at 44.
▶ 20:01Guilt about deceased loved ones not seeing grandchildren can sabotage your fertility journey
Robin carried guilt that her father said he'd never be a grandfather before he passed away. She transformed this by carrying his picture and letter to her transfer, reframing his presence as supportive rather than guilt-inducing.
▶ 25:18The insurance system can work in your favor when timing aligns with your journey
Robin's insurance did a revamp giving everyone a clean slate with three new IVF rounds just as she was running out of coverage. This 'divine intervention' allowed her to continue treatment and eventually succeed.
▶ 6:41Apparent bad omens can become catalysts for breakthrough when reframed properly
Robin saw a black cat before her transfer and panicked about bad luck. This triggered her to work with her therapist and carry her father's picture to the transfer, transforming guilt into support and leading to her successful pregnancy.

Teachings3
Setbacks and delays often serve a purpose in preparing you for success
Robin got sick before her planned transfer but believes the universe delayed it because she wasn't ready. The extra time allowed her to work on mindset and build her support network, leading to success when she transferred in November.
▶ 20:42Listening to mindset content isn't enough - you must put the teachings into practice
Robin listened to the Fearlessly Fertile podcast for a full year before getting coaching. She realized that while the content helped, she needed to actively practice the mindset shifts to see real results.
▶ 32:00Advanced maternal age stories can be empowering when you find examples of success
Robin was inspired hearing Rosanne had her baby at 43, thinking 'this could be me' when she was also 43. She went on to conceive at 44, showing how success stories at similar ages can fuel belief.

Reframes1
Accepting donor eggs doesn't mean the baby isn't yours - you're the one carrying and raising the child
Robin initially resisted donor eggs saying 'not me' but shifted to understanding that even though the egg didn't come from her, the baby still came from her through pregnancy and she would be raising it.
